mirror of
http://172.20.10.11:3000/gitadmin/INSIGHT-MVP.git
synced 2026-06-25 06:26:40 +02:00
BulletEditor (ProjectModal.tsx): - blWrapFormat(): wrap/unwrap Selektion mit Marker-Paar (**/*/__), leere Selektion → leeres Marker-Paar mit Cursor dazwischen - Buttons: B (Fett **), I (Kursiv *), U (Unterstrichen __) - Shortcuts: Strg/Cmd + B/I/U in handleKeyDown ProjectsSection.tsx: - renderInline(): regex-basierter Inline-Markdown-Renderer ohne dangerouslySetInnerHTML — wandelt **bold**, *italic*, __underline__ um - RichText-Komponente: rendert Aufgaben-Text mit Bullets, Nummernlisten, Einrueckung und Inline-Formatierung - Projektliste zeigt Aufgaben unterhalb der Taetigkeitszeile an (nur wenn vorhanden, mit border-top als optischem Trenner) - Layout-Anpassung: entryItemExpanded + entryItemRow fuer vertikales Layout CSS: bulletBtnBold/Italic/Underline, entryItemExpanded/Row, entryTasks, richText/Line/Bullet/Num/Blank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| src | ||
| .dockerignore | ||
| Dockerfile | ||
| index.html | ||
| nginx.conf | ||
| package-lock.json | ||
| package.json | ||
| tsconfig.json | ||
| vite-env.d.ts | ||
| vite.config.ts | ||